 “1792” Liberty Cap & Pole Large Cent – Production Blog

 

All are over-struck on genuine US Mint Large Cents (circa 1794-1857).

The first year for US Mint large cents was 1793. No large cents were originally produced dated 1792.

 

NOTE: These are NOT endorsed by the US Treasury. Defacing of US coins is legal so long as the defacement isn't for fraudulent purposes.
